The Minister of Home Affairs Emphasizes The Importance of Adequate Facilities and Infrastructure for Training Institutions

Jakarta, The Indonesia Post – The Minister of Home Affairs, Prof. Drs. H. Muhammad Tito Karnavian, M.A, Ph.D emphasizes that each training institute must have training facilities and infrastructure which include furniture, training equipment, training media, books and other learning resources, and other necessary equipment.

Besides that, he emphasizes that training institute must also have facilities that include land, classrooms, leadership rooms, administration rooms, library rooms, laboratory rooms, canteen rooms, power and service installations, sports venues, places of worship and other spaces / places needed to support the learning process. regular and ongoing.

Furthermore, the minister who was born in Palembang, South Sumatra believes that success of education and training or competency development is largely determined by in addition to the presence of training participants, training organizers, lecturers, modules / teaching materials, but also adequate training facilities or infrastructure. Although this component is considered a support, its existence will determine the success or failure of training.

“Training facilities are needed because they will help organizers and lecturers in the teaching and learning process in the classroom. The availability of adequate and adequate facilities and infrastructure (sapras) for a training institution greatly determines the success of the apparatus competency development program,” said the Minister of Home Affairs, Prof. Drs. H. Muhammad Tito Karnavian, M.A, Ph.D who was accompanied by the Secretary General of the Ministry of Home Affairs, Mr. Dr. Ir. Muhammad Hudori, M.Si during his Working Visit at the Ministry of Home Affairs’ BPSDM Office, Friday January 15, 2021.

He added, considering the importance of training facilities as a vehicle for teaching and learning activities both in class and outside the classroom, its existence is a necessity for an education and training institution in which there are adequate supporting facilities and infrastructure. Training facilities are one of the inputs in the education quality assurance system. The existence and choice of the type, quantity, quality of these facilities depends on the needs. Management of training facilities must be carried out in an integrated manner. For this reason, it is necessary to plan the appropriate facility requirements. The facility arrangement must be able to be utilized more effectively and efficiently and in accordance with the quality assurance of training facilities in the education and training institution, said Tito Karnavian.

To ensure that, the Ministry of Home Affairs’ BPSDM facilities and infrastructure are adequate in supporting the implementation of the competency development program of the Minister of Home Affairs together with the Secretary General and entourage accompanied by the Head of BPSDM of the Ministry of Home Affairs, DR. Drs. Teguh Setyabudi, M.Pd monitors and sees directly several office spaces and study rooms, including the Auditorium Room, Classroom, 3rd Floor Mini Studio Room, Building F, Theater Room, 2nd Floor Mini Studio Room, Building F, Head Room and Cendrawasih Room. On the sidelines of monitoring office and study rooms, the Minister of Home Affairs said that it is not easy to eliminate the habit of some people who have a smoking habit, therefore the smoking ban set in several places must also be balanced with the provision of a smoking area for smokers. , he said.
